The education system is different over here. After school is two years of college with three or four subjects of equal worth. Then it's on to university for a 3 to 5 year course. I'm at the end of my first year of college (the second year starts after my exams, which I'm in the middle of). I study English Literature, Theology and Philosophy. They keep trying to make me finish off Graphics. At university (I'm looking at Scotland at the moment; St. Andrews or Edinburgh) I want to study English Literature or Classics with Latin. If I can't do Latin, I'll look at Russian. Few colleges do an A-Level in Russian so you can usually start from scratch. |
